How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cornell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cornell Heights 1 Bedroom Apartments | $820 | $650 | $1,145 |
| Cornell Heights 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,006 | $750 | $1,674 |
| Cornell Heights 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,093 | $850 | $1,200 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Cornell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,063 | $850 | $1,656 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$1,186 | $925 | $1,700 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$1,290 | $1,200 | $1,400 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$1,800 | $1,750 | $1,850 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cornell Heights
What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in the Cornell Heights area of Dayton, OH?
As of today, July 27, 2026, there are currently 575 available Cornell Heights apartments priced from $650 to $1,674, with an average monthly rent of $962.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cornell Heights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cornell Heights ranges from $650 to $1,145 with an average monthly rent of $820.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cornell Heights c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cornell Heights range from $750 to $1,674.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,006.
How expensive are Cornell Heights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 28 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Cornell Heights on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$850 to $1,200 - averaging $1,093 for the location.
